List of architectural monuments in Krakow am See

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

In the list of architectural monuments in Krakow am See all listed buildings in the city of Krakow am See (Mecklenburg-Western Pomerania) and its districts are listed. The basis is the publication of the list of monuments of the district of Güstrow - Altkreis Güstrow as of October 4, 1996.

1983

Markt / Kirchenstrasse
(map)
church Elongated brick building in Romanesque - Gothic transition style from the 13th century, later considerably redesigned several times, preserved east gable with frieze and decoration ; Today's construction mainly from 1762, octagonal copper-covered roof turret with clock, pulpit and altarpiece from 1705, gallery with coat of arms from 1744 church

2008

School place 2
(map)
synagogue Single-storey, neo-Romanesque , rectangular building with yellow brick facade and gable roof from 1866, used as a gym from 1820, therefore preserved, cultural center since 1986 synagogue

1193

Am Schloß 19
(map)
Manor complex with manor house, park, lime tree avenue with cobblestone pavement, granary, stable and farm building The two-story brick building with 13 axes, granite base and hipped roof was designed in 1859 by the Wismar architect Heinrich Thormann . After several renovations in 1888 and 1905, it was given its current appearance. Manor complex with manor house, park, lime tree avenue with cobblestone pavement, granary, stable and farm building
1194

Lindenstrasse 10
(map)
church Simple field stone building from the 13th century, west tower built in 1863, dilapidated and closed in 1960, roof structure of the nave collapsed in 1979, reconstruction 1984–1987, 1990 awarded the Europa Nostra Prize church

1220

Am Karpendiek
(map)
Church with cemetery gate and Reimann tomb in the cemetery Late Romanesque , single-nave stone building from around 1230 with a stone sarcophagus, font basin, carved figures and wall and ceiling paintings; 4-tier later, massive, square west tower made of (below) field and (above) bricks with a mansard roof Church with cemetery gate and Reimann tomb in the cemetery
